2. Ensuring Safety & Stability in Austin’s Construction Projects
Structural engineers in Austin design buildings that can withstand environmental challenges, such as extreme heat, high winds, and heavy rainfall. Their expertise helps prevent structural failures, ensuring long-term safety and stability for both residential and commercial properties.

4. Cutting-Edge Technology in Structural Engineering
With advancements in Building Information Modeling (BIM), AI-driven simulations, and 3D structural analysis, engineers can create precise and innovative designs. These technologies help identify potential structural issues before construction begins, saving time and money.

3. What are the key materials used in structural engineering?
Common materials include steel, concrete, wood, and composite materials, selected based on structural requirements.
